Exploiting shape effects of La2O3 nanocatalysts for oxidative coupling of methane reaction

High activity towards oxidative coupling of methane and high selectivity for C-2 hydrocarbons could be achieved over La2O3 nanorods with a large surface area, strong surface basic sites, electron deficient surface oxygen species and defined surface structure compared with La2O3 nanoparticles at low temperature.
